I have played Chrono Cross and I can say that I enjoyed it. Though my memory is definitely slurred today. It featured a different battle system which imho was better than Trigger minus the lack of combos. Good storyline as well.

It offered an endless supply of characters that were obtainable through different events as you play. What does that mean to you? It means for each replay, you could end up with an entirely different assault of characters. Minus the two necessary main chars.

If you played Chrono Trigger on the SNES, the change to the playstation would serve as a disappointment due to the adjustment of major lag when entering new areas as was common with most psx games.
